The Appeal of Round
Cut Diamond Rings
Round cut diamonds are known for their exceptional
brilliance and symmetry. Their 58-facet structure maximizes light reflection,
creating an unmatched sparkle. When set in an elegant band, they exude grace
and sophistication, making them the ideal choice for an engagement ring
with round diamond.
Modern Twists on
Classic Round Cut Designs
While the traditional solitaire remains a timeless favorite,
contemporary twists have emerged, giving these rings a fresh and unique touch.
Here are some modern takes on classic round cut diamond rings:
1. The Hidden Halo
Setting
A hidden halo setting features small diamonds beneath the
main stone, adding a discreet sparkle that enhances the brilliance of the
engagement ring with round diamond without overwhelming its simplicity.
2. Twisted Band
Designs
A modern spin on the traditional band, twisted designs offer
a delicate and romantic appeal. They symbolize the intertwining of two lives,
making them perfect for couples looking for a meaningful design.
3. Bezel Settings for
a Sleek Look
Bezel settings encase the diamond in a smooth metal rim,
providing a contemporary and protective design. It’s an excellent choice for
those who lead an active lifestyle and want durability without compromising
elegance.
4. Lab Grown Diamonds
for Ethical Beauty
More couples are now opting for lab grown diamonds in their
wedding rings. These diamonds offer the same brilliance and durability as mined
ones but are a more sustainable and ethical choice.
Choosing the Perfect
Round Cut Diamond Wedding Ring
Selecting the perfect engagement ring with round diamond
involves several key considerations:
1. The 4Cs of Diamond
Quality
Understanding the cut, color, clarity, and carat weight
helps in choosing a ring that matches your preferences and budget. A well-cut
round diamond ensures maximum brilliance and fire.
2. Metal Choices for
Modern Appeal
Round cut diamonds pair beautifully with various metals:
- White Gold & Platinum: A sleek, modern look that
enhances the diamond’s brilliance.
- Yellow Gold: A vintage-inspired option that complements
warm skin tones.
- Rose Gold: A romantic and contemporary choice that adds a
touch of uniqueness.
3. Ethical
Considerations
Opting for lab grown diamonds ensures that your ring is
conflict-free and environmentally responsible while still offering the same
dazzling appeal as natural diamonds.
Caring for Your Round
Cut Diamond Ring
To maintain the beauty of your ring, follow these care tips:
- Regular Cleaning: Use a mild soap solution and a soft
brush to clean your diamond gently.
- Safe Storage: Store your ring separately to prevent
scratches.
- Professional Checkups: Visit a jeweler for regular
inspections to ensure the setting remains secure.
